Output 58269a37fafcfc469b1e64afe6cc113fdd52cdc75371db4736e1fe7ea7e034cd:0

value
10778420
script pubkey
OP_HASH160 OP_PUSHBYTES_20 311245f447dda308da1c419f2ed14c2603639a89 OP_EQUAL
address
MCNdEUgkTANxJZfum7T6VEqfSCD2ef94KA
transaction
58269a37fafcfc469b1e64afe6cc113fdd52cdc75371db4736e1fe7ea7e034cd
spent
true